Transaction 95752049e32b63989a86cb203de47f005998bff4862138887b9e8b199dfee9cd
1 Input
2 Outputs
- 95752049e32b63989a86cb203de47f005998bff4862138887b9e8b199dfee9cd:0
- 95752049e32b63989a86cb203de47f005998bff4862138887b9e8b199dfee9cd:1
value 233916
address 177CxRAqXtUb5qE6cRy17D2rutVUcpY3yH
value 377521
address 34ZhinSRvqu493KTvE1uxVZoh4Fwfu96kV